Cambridge Audio L/R X Advanced Active Stereo Streaming Speakers
The Cambridge Audio L/R X is a premium active stereo speaker system built for listeners who want powerful hi-fi sound, modern streaming convenience, and elegant design without the need for a separate amplifier. Delivering 800 watts of total power through a custom acoustic system with 28mm tweeters, dual 5-inch woofers, and dual 6-inch passive radiators, L/R X brings the scale, depth, and authority of a larger floor-standing setup into a compact speaker pair. StreamMagic Gen 4 gives you high-resolution access to Spotify Connect, TIDAL Connect, Amazon Music, Qobuz Connect, Roon Ready, Internet Radio, UPnP, Google Cast, and AirPlay 2, while HDMI eARC, USB, optical, RCA aux, MM phono, Bluetooth, Ethernet, and Wi-Fi make it easy to connect nearly any source. With room optimization tools, DynamEQ, advanced speaker protection, underlighting, bold finish options, and deep bass extension down to 35Hz, the L/R X is designed to sound precise, powerful, and immersive in modern living spaces.

Cambridge Audio L/R X Advanced Active Stereo Streaming Speakers Q&A:
- Do the Cambridge Audio L/R X speakers need a separate amplifier?
- No. L/R X is an active stereo speaker system with amplification, signal processing, and tuning built into the speakers, so no external amplifier is required.
- Can the L/R X play music without being connected to a network?
- No. L/R X is a network player and requires a network connection to function properly, including source selection and control through the StreamMagic app. Keeping it connected also helps ensure firmware, security, and service compatibility updates stay current.
- What streaming services work with the Cambridge Audio L/R X?
- L/R X supports Spotify Connect, TIDAL Connect, Amazon Music, Qobuz Connect, Roon Ready, Internet Radio, UPnP, Google Cast, and AirPlay 2 through the StreamMagic Gen 4 platform.
- Can I connect a TV to the L/R X?
- Yes. The L/R X includes an HDMI eARC input, allowing compatible TVs to send audio to the speakers and, when configured, control volume and power from the TV remote.
- Can I connect a turntable to the L/R X?
- Yes. The L/R X includes an RCA MM phono input for turntables with moving magnet cartridges. When using the phono input, the turntable ground should be connected to the speaker’s ground tab.
- Does the L/R X need a separate subwoofer?
- Not necessarily. The speakers use dual 5-inch woofers and dual 6-inch passive radiators to deliver bass extension down to 35Hz, but an RCA subwoofer output is included if additional low-end output is desired.
- How do the two L/R X speakers connect to each other?
- The speakers can link wirelessly using WiSA HT or with the supplied 5m USB-C speaker link cable. The wired link is useful in spaces where wireless interference may affect stability.
- How are EQ and sound settings adjusted on the L/R X?
- EQ and audio customization are handled through the StreamMagic app, with Normal, Movie, and Voice modes available. The system also includes DynamEQ, room optimization tools, and advanced speaker protection for balanced performance.
